GPS Paschimibandwar, a government primary school located in the Begusarai district of Bihar, India, offers a glimpse into the educational landscape of rural India. Established in 1952, this co-educational institution serves students from Class 1 to Class 5, providing a foundational education within the community.
The school's infrastructure comprises a pucca but broken building, housing seven classrooms suitable for instruction. While lacking modern amenities like electricity and a computer lab, the school provides essential facilities including hand pumps for drinking water and separate functional toilets for boys and girls. The absence of a playground and library, however, highlights areas needing improvement.
The school's academic focus is primarily on Hindi as the medium of instruction. A dedicated teaching staff of seven, including two male and five female teachers, ensures that students receive the necessary attention. The provision of midday meals prepared on the school premises is a vital support system, ensuring students' nutritional needs are met.
The school's management lies with the Department of Education, emphasizing its role within the government's educational framework. The rural setting dictates the accessibility and resources available to the institution. Importantly, the school is easily accessible by road, irrespective of weather conditions, making it readily available to the community it serves. The school operates on a standard academic calendar, commencing its session in April.
